La Gare

Why locals love it

Although La Gare feels like a homey place where they want you to be happy, and are accommodating, it is still quite posh, with linen tablecloths and a huge, plush leopard print curtain at the front door to keep out the cold. Wines are a 'big deal,' as befits a French establishment, and have some other than the usual fare in most places.

Why you should visit it

It is famous for Sunday brunch Eggs Benedict with champagne, but also has a nice limited menu, which is much larger during the week. We had a window seat and waitresses who were personable and informative. I am a dessert 'nut' and admitted to being disappointed in the caramel cake. It came off the bill immediately, rare in Prague!

Special tip

They also have a take-out patisserie of in-house desserts and a small selection of cheeses, pates, and groceries from France, not to mention wines.
